    Gold Coast City Council has just closed a tender for a contractor to provide design and installation services its intelligent transport system infrastructure, including CCTV. 

    The selected provider will be required to appoint a suitably experienced, qualified and equipped electronic security contractor to undertake the supply and installation of a number of CCTV ‘packages of work’ across the Gold Coast’s ITS. 

    Queensland’s Intelligent Transport Systems (ITS) is described as a “whole-of-government approach to innovation and industry” that will transform the way transport systems operate. ITS applications and strategies aim to improve safety, reduce traffic congestion reduce environmental impacts.

    The motorway and arterial ITS applications incorporate traffic management centres in Brisbane and at the Gold and Sunshine Coasts, compiling relevant data and information via closed-circuit television (CCTV) cameras. This information is then broadcast through a traffic hotline (13 19 40). ♦
